Soldiers Shoot Two Taraba Policemen Dead, Injure Others
The Taraba State Police Command on Monday accused soldiers of shooting two policemen to death at a military checkpoint close to the INEC headquarters in the Jalingo area of the state.
Confirming the development to the News Agency of Nigeria, the state Police Public Relations Officer, Abdullahi Usman, said two other policemen were sustained injuries during the attack were receiving treatment in hospital, adding that an investigation would be conducted to ascertain the cause of the incident.
He also noted that the soldiers, after perpetrating the crime around 8.30am, ran away with the rifles of the policemen.
Usman said, “The state Commissioner of Police, Yusuf Suleiman, and the Commander 6 Brigade, Brig. Gen. Frank Etim, have met, discussed and agreed that a commission of enquiry be set up to look into the cause of this incident.
“The soldiers shot two police personnel and went away with their rifles. Some proceeded to the command headquarters with guns and shot sporadically in the air, and one police officer who was going off duty was shot and killed instantly.
“Another who was just reporting for duty and did not even know what was happening was also shot the moment they identified him as a policeman.
“As we speak, we have gotten reports that our men who are escorting election results or on various duties are being stopped at military checkpoints and harassed.”
